Telecommunications Vulnerability Intelligence

Telecom operators manage the backbone of digital connectivity. Compromised telecom infrastructure enables mass surveillance, call interception, and disruption of emergency services.

SS7/Diameter Protocol Exploitation

CriticalSS7 Attacks (Demonstrated at DEF CON)

Legacy signaling protocol vulnerabilities enabling call interception, SMS redirection, location tracking, and two-factor authentication bypass across the global telecom network.

5G Network Slicing Isolation Failures

Critical

Insufficient isolation between 5G network slices allowing cross-slice data leakage, resource exhaustion, and unauthorized access to enterprise-dedicated network segments.

SIM Swapping and eSIM Hijacking

High

Social engineering and API exploitation enabling unauthorized SIM profile transfers, account takeover, and interception of SMS-based authentication codes.

BSS/OSS Platform Vulnerabilities

HighCVE-2024-1709

Business and Operations Support Systems with SQL injection, privilege escalation, and API authorization flaws enabling access to subscriber data and billing manipulation.
